POPS POLAMALU TO MISS MONDAY’S GAME? Posted by Mike Florio on October 31, 2008, 4:34 p.m. The guy who won’t let a little concussion (or 12) keep him from playing football might miss a game due to something unrelated to his own health and well-being. Steelers safety Troy Polamalu is expecting his first child, a son. According to the Beaver County Times, he possibly won’t be with the team on Monday night in D.C. as Pittsburgh prepares to play the Redskins. Asked whether the situation might result in Polamalu not playing, he said, “I don’t know. We’ll see what happens.” Tim Benz of WXDX in Pittsburgh advises us that Polamalu didn’t practice on Friday, but no reason was given for his absence other than that it was non-football related. I would pick the Redskins to win if we were relatively healthy. However, our Pro Bowl left tackle, Pro Bowl #1 wide receiver, Pro Bowl left defensive end, Pro Bowl #1 corner, best interior defensive lineman, and Carlos Rogers and Laron Landry all "Out" or "Questionable."
Also, the Steelers' biggest weakness is pass protection and we don't appear to have the pass rushing firepower to exploit that weakness. Conversely, one of our bigger weaknesses lies in pass protection and the Steelers' greatest strengths is pass rushing. With Samuels hurt and Jansen a liability in pass protection, I think it's reasonable to see JC get sacked between 3-5 times. End result - an ugly 24-14 Steelers win. On the bright side, we enter the bye at the right time with a 6-3 record. |
